What is a Systematic Investment Plan (SIP)?
A Systematic Investment Plan (SIP) is a disciplined method of investing a fixed sum of money regularly (typically monthly) in a mutual fund scheme. SIPs allow you to buy units on a predetermined date, helping you participate in equity markets without trying to time the market.

Benefits of SIP Investing
Rupee Cost Averaging
When the stock market is down, your fixed monthly payment buys more mutual fund units. When markets are up, it buys fewer units. Over time, this averages out the acquisition cost per unit.
The Power of Compounding
Earnings from your investments are reinvested back into the mutual fund, earning additional returns. Over a long tenure (10+ years), compounding significantly expands your initial capital.
Promotes Savings Discipline
Automating your monthly SIP on your payday ensures you pay yourself first before discretionary spending.
